For compatibility with MIT Kerberos, support automatic acquisition of initiator
credentials if a client keytab is available. The default path on non-Windows is
/var/heimdal/user/%{euid}/client.keytab, but can be overriden with the
KRB5_CLIENT_KTNAME environment variable or the default_client_keytab_name
configuration option. If a client keytab does not exist, or exists but does not
contain the principal for which initiator credentials are being acquired, the
system keytab is tried.

Since c6bf100b password quality checks have been moved out of kadmindd and into
libkadm5. This means that all password changes are subject to quality checks,
if enforce_on_admin_set is true (the default). In rare instances it could be
possible for realm initialization to fail because the randomly generated
passwords do not pass the password quality test. Fix this by creating
principals with no password or key, rather than with a random password.
Random *keys* continue to be set immediately after the principal is created,
and before DISALLOW_ALL_TIX is unset, so there should be no functionality or
security implications from this change. It is safe to call a server-side API
such as kadm5_s_create_principal_with_key() as local_flag is asserted to be
true.

Prior to this change a KDC response of KRB5KDC_ERR_SVC_UNAVAILABLE
would result in the client looping forever. Setting the action to
KRB5_SENTO_CONTINUE repeats the current loop without altering the
current state. Hence the infinite loop.
As of this change, the action is set to KRB5_SENDTO_RESET which
forces the current kdc's response to be cleared and then to retry.
If KRB5KDC_ERR_SVC_UNAVAILABLE continues to be returned, the retry
limit will be reached and the loop will end.
This bug was filed by multiple sources including Samba and ScottUrban
on github.

When connect() fails in connect_unix() the path_ctx.fd is not
set to -1 after close(). When common_release() is executed due
to the error return from connect_unix() it calls close() a second
time.
There is no need to call close() from connect_unix(). Remove the
duplicate request.
This issue was reported by YASUOKA Masahiko.

Update gen-punycode-examples.py for python 3.
gen-punycode-examples.py parses the Sample strings from section 7.1
of rfc3492.txt and generates the punycode_examples.[ch] sources containing
the punycode_examples[].
Python 3 requires that print output be surrounded by parentheses
and the split and join operations have been moved from the "string"
class to built-ins.
This change adds the missing parentheses and switches to the built-in
split and join str operations.
The "string" class is no longer required as an import.

This change adds plugin support to the kadmin libraries for performing
actions before and after a password change is committed to the KDC database
and after a change is made to the attributes of a principal (specifically,
a change to DISALLOW_ALL_TIX).
This change adds a hook_libraries configuration option to the [kadmin]
section of krb5.conf (or kdc.conf if you use that file) that must be set
to load the module. That configuration option is in the form:
[kadmin]
hook_libraries = /usr/local/lib/krb5/plugins/kadm5_hook/krb5_sync.so
where the value is the full path to the plugin that you want to load. If
this option is not present, kadmind will not load a plugin and the changes
from the patch will be inactive. If this option is given and the plugin
cannot be loaded, kadmind startup will abort with a (hopefully useful)
error message in syslog.
Any plugin used with this patch must expose a public function named
kadm5_hook_init of type kadm5_hook_init_t that returns a kadm5_hook structure.
See sample_hook.c for an example of this initialization function.
typedef struct kadm5_hook {
const char *name;
uint32_t version;
const char *vendor;
void (KRB5_CALLCONV *fini)(krb5_context, void *data);
krb5_error_code (KRB5_CALLCONV *chpass)(krb5_context context,
void *data,
enum kadm5_hook_stage stage,
krb5_error_code code,
krb5_const_principal princ,
uint32_t flags,
size_t n_ks_tuple,
krb5_key_salt_tuple *ks_tuple,
const char *password,
char **error_msg);
...
};
where enum kadm5_hook_stage is:
enum kadm5_hook_stage {
KADM5_HOOK_STAGE_PRECOMMIT,
KADM5_HOOK_STAGE_POSTCOMMIT
};
init creates a hook context that is passed into all subsequent calls.
chpass is called for password changes, create is called for principal
creation (with the newly-created principal in the kadm5_principal_ent_t
argument), and modify is called when a principal is modified. The purpose of
the remaining functions should be self-explanatory.
returning 0 on success and a Kerberos error code on failure, setting the
Kerberos error message in the provided context. The error code passed in is
valid for post-commit hooks and contains the result of the update operation.

This patch adds the "enforce_on_admin_set" configuration knob in the
[password_quality] section. When this is enabled, administrative password
changes via the kadmin or kpasswd protocols will be subject to password quality
checks. (An administrative password change is one where the authenticating
principal is different to the principal whose password is being changed.)
Note that kadmin running in local mode (-l) is unaffected by this patch.
Using non-reentrant getpwuid() (or getpwnam(), or getspnam()) can be
dangerous. We had a report of a login application / PAM that calls
those, and Heimdal, by calling them too, clobbered the cached struct
passwd used by the login app / PAM.
We add roken_get_{shell, username, appdatadir, homedir}() functions. These use
a combination of secure_getenv(), getpwuid_r(), getlogin_r(), or various WIN32
functions to get this information.
Use roken_get_appdatadir() instead of roken_get_homedir() when looking for
dotfiles.
